GC-MS分析尿液中甲卡西酮

摘    要:目的建立尿液中甲卡西酮的气相色谱-质谱(gas chromatography-mass spectrometry,GC-MS)分析方法。方法在尿液中加入内标双苯戊二氨酯(SKF525A)和pH=9的缓冲溶液,用乙酸乙酯提取,提取液在50℃氮气流下挥干,残余物用甲醇溶解,用GC-MS分析。结果尿液中甲卡西酮在0.02~2.00μg/m L质量浓度范围内线性关系良好,线性方程为y=0.301 9 x+0.018 9(r=0.999 2),检出限为0.01μg/m L。尿液中甲卡西酮回收率为96.4%~99.2%,日内精密度为5.8%~7.6%,日间精密度为6.0%~8.1%。结论该方法操作简便、灵敏度高,可用于司法鉴定实践尿液样品中甲卡西酮的分析。


Determination of Methcathinone in Urine by GC-MS
Abstract:Objective To establish a method for the analysis of methcathinone in urine by gas chromatography-mass spectrometry (GC-MS).Methods Proadifen hydrochloride (internal standard) and buffer solution (pH=9) were added into the urine samples,and methcathinone was extracted by ethyl acetate.The extract was volatilized in 50 ℃ nitrogen gas flow and the remnant was dissolved by methanol and analysed by GC-MS.Results The methcathinone in urine showed a good linear relationship in the mass concentration range of 0.02-2.00 μg/mL.The linear equation was y=0.301 9x+0.0189 (r=0.9992),and the detection limit was 0.01 μg/mL.The recoveries of methcathinone in urine was 96.4%-99.2%,with the intraday precision of 5.8%-7.6% and the inter-day precision of 6.0%-8.1%.Conclusion The method is convenient and sensitive,which can be applied to the forensic identification of methcathinone in urine.
